Computer Programs and Systems' Inpatient Electronic Medical Record Receives Certification From CCHIT(SM)

Posted on: Monday, 5 November 2007, 15:00 CST

Computer Programs and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: CPSI), a leading provider of healthcare information solutions, today announced its receipt of certification from the Certification Commission for Healthcare Information Technology (CCHIT(SM)) for its inpatient electronic medical record (EMR) product. CPSI is now CCHIT Certified(SM) for the CPSI System, Version 15, for CCHIT Inpatient EMR 2007. CCHIT is the recognized certification authority for electronic health records (EHRs). Its mission is to accelerate the adoption of robust, interoperable healthcare information technology throughout the United States by creating an efficient, credible, sustainable mechanism for the certification of healthcare IT products.

The CPSI System is a fully integrated health information system providing a comprehensive EMR solution targeted specifically to community healthcare providers. The system offers a complete array of financial and clinical applications including revenue cycle management and advanced clinical systems such as point of care documentation, a web-based physician portal to the EMR, CPOE and PACS. The resulting system provides CPSI clients with an EMR that virtually eliminates reliance on paper records, increases patient safety and helps to improve patient outcomes.

To achieve certification, the CPSI System was subjected to CCHIT's inspection process comprised of real-life medical scenarios designed to test products rigorously against clinical documentation needs of providers and the quality and safety needs of healthcare consumers and payers. Certification by CCHIT designates that an EHR product has passed inspection of 100% of CCHIT's criteria for functionality, interoperability and security.

The CPSI System joins CPSI's ambulatory EMR product and Medical Practice EMR in receiving certification from CCHIT. CPSI's Medical Practice EMR, Version 14, is currently CCHIT Certified(SM) for CCHIT Ambulatory EMR 2006.

About Certification Commission for Healthcare Information Technology (CCHIT(SM))

CCHIT was founded in July 2004 by three healthcare information technology industry associations - the American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A), the Healthcare Information and Management Systems Society (HIMSS) and the National Alliance for Health Information Technology (Alliance). The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) awarded CCHIT a three-year contract in September 2005 to develop and evaluate certification criteria and an inspection process for ambulatory (office and clinic) EHRs, inpatient (hospital) EHRs and the networks through which they interoperate. About Computer Programs and Systems, Inc.

CPSI is a leading provider of healthcare information solutions for community hospitals with over 600 client hospitals in 46 states. Founded in 1979, the Company is a single-source vendor providing comprehensive software and hardware products, complemented by complete installation services and extensive support. Its fully integrated, enterprise-wide system automates clinical and financial data management in each of the primary functional areas of a hospital. CPSI's staff of over 800 technical, healthcare and medical professionals provides system implementation and continuing support services as part of a comprehensive program designed to respond to clients' information needs in a constantly changing healthcare environment.
